Package: ejabberd Version: 14.05-1~experimental2 Severity: grave Hi folks,
when upgrading from 2.1.x to 14.05 the configuration of the Mnesia database is not properly updated. While older versions used ejabberd@$(hostname) for the EJABBERD_NODE it is ejabberd@localhost for the most recent one. This change is not reflected during the upgrade and causes the upgraded server to fail to start (with meaningless erlang error messages worth submitting to NIST as a new form of random bitstring generation - can't be worse than DualEC DRBG). Updating /etc/default/ejabberd to use the old value of ejabberd@$(hostname) for the EJABBERD_NODE setting solves the issue.
